contrib/lisp/org-contacts.el: Permit to unload properly `org-contacts'
commitc82b34adb611e2f5652d2aa201276a6862d7ec4d
authorGrégoire Jadi <gregoire.jadi@gmail.com>
Wed, 8 May 2013 22:31:16 +0000 (9 00:31 +0200)
committerGrégoire Jadi <gregoire.jadi@gmail.com>
Wed, 8 May 2013 22:37:53 +0000 (9 00:37 +0200)
tree9b9b4f8c258480d90824d9c67cb7ce52b5eaec6b
parent800ea286c48692f2438550e7eecbc915c1999dc9
contrib/lisp/org-contacts.el: Permit to unload properly `org-contacts'

* contrib/lisp/org-contacts.el (org-contacts-setup-completion-at-point):
Setup `completion-at-point-functions' in a dedicated function so it's
easier to add and to remove it from `message-mode-hook'.
(org-contacts-unload-hook): This function removes all hooks added while
loading `org-contacts' in order to respect Emacs coding conventions.
contrib/lisp/org-contacts.el